"Article 15" is a 2019 Indian Hindi-language crime drama that stands out as one of the most important Bollywood films of its decade. Directed and produced by Anubhav Sinha, who co-wrote the screenplay with Gaurav Solanki, the film is a searing indictment of the caste-based discrimination that continues to plague rural India.
